The Rise of Digital Billboards

Dynamic Content Delivery

The development of digital billboards has transformed the landscape of OOH advertising, allowing for real-time content updates that breathe new life into the medium. Advertisers now possess the flexibility to alter messages instantaneously, tailoring them to reflect the current moment’s relevance, whether dictated by unfolding events, fluctuating weather conditions, or shifting demographic profiles. This capacity for dynamic content delivery eliminates the static nature that once defined traditional billboards, allowing advertisements to be timely and resonant. This real-time adaptability not only enhances ad relevance but also increases the likelihood of capturing consumer attention amid the constant bombardment of information they face every day. It represents a significant leap toward smarter advertising strategies, making OOH a medium where precision meets creativity.

Interaction and Connectivity

OOH advertising has embraced an interactive renaissance, substantially fueled by the widespread presence of mobile devices in modern life. The incorporation of interactive elements—such as touchscreens and augmented reality—has deepened the engagement between brands and consumers. No longer resigned to passive viewership, audiences can now directly interact with the physical ads, enriching their experience and fostering a more memorable connection with the brand. QR codes, Near Field Communication (NFC), and the rise of other bridging technologies unite the physical and digital worlds, creating seamless interactions that resonate more deeply with tech-savvy consumers. This enhanced connectivity is not just a novelty; it forms the cornerstone of a new paradigm in advertising, one where consumer participation is a central element.

Data-Driven Insights

Targeting and Engagement

As data becomes a formidable cornerstone in advertising strategy, OOH has tapped into its potential, using data analytics to sculpt more precise targeting and engagement profiles. Data sourced from cutting-edge GPS tracking, sophisticated traffic pattern analyses, and mobile location records empower advertisers to dissect and comprehend their audience’s behaviors and locales with increased accuracy. This meticulous data-driven approach allows campaigns to be tailored with pinpoint precision, targeting advertisements in high-traffic areas or zones densely populated by the desired demographic to maximize reach and efficacy. This strategy translates into ads that not only engage effectively but also achieve a more impressive return on investment, as brands can reach precisely who they intend to at exactly the right moment.

Programmatic Buying

Efficiencies in advertising have also been realized through the dawn of programmatic technology, which offers an automated, real-time approach to media buying. By utilizing real-time data insights, this method accelerates the purchasing process, allowing advertisers to determine the optimal timing and locations for their campaigns with unprecedented ease. Such automation streamlines campaign management, liberating resources, and granting smaller brands the opportunity to engage OOH advertising platforms without needing hefty budgets. As programmatic buying becomes more widespread, it democratizes access to premium advertising spaces and reduces inefficiency, making these traditionally exclusive ad spaces approachable and viable for brands of any size aiming for strategic, data-informed deployment.

Sustainability and Challenges

Eco-Friendly Initiatives

Environmental sustainability has become an integral component of the evolving OOH advertising realm. Digital billboards are increasingly powered by sustainable energy sources, including wind and solar power, showcasing a commitment to minimizing environmental impact. This growing trend aligns with heightened consumer expectations surrounding environmental responsibility. Advertisers are also gravitating towards the use of recyclable materials in producing billboards, ensuring the infrastructure of advertising contributes positively to ecological conversations. These practices are not only environmentally responsible; they resonate with consumers who care deeply about brand ethics, enhancing overall brand reputation and fostering consumer trust.
